Back to newsThe Dover Academy boys have reached the final of the ‘Champion of Champions’ in the National Youth Alliance
Posted on May 16th 2019The Dover Academy boys have reached the final of the ‘Champion of Champions’ in the National Youth Alliance after beating AFC Stamford 1-0.
Ryan Kingsford scored the only goal after 30 minutes. We will now play Eastleigh in the final next Wednesday in a 14.00 kick-off at Oxford City FC.
It is such a fantastic achievement to be in the final out of all the academies in the country and goes to show where our group of players are and how hard they are willing to work to develop. The final will be the last game for some of our players and it’s been an absolute pleasure to enjoy their progress and development.
The group have been excellent throughout this season and still remain unbeaten. Whatever happens next week in the final I couldn’t be more proud of them. We will be hoping to be crowned the best academy in the country next week and I know the lads will do everything possible to make that happen.
Mike Sandmann, Academy Manager
